@charset "gb2312";

body{ background-color:#fff; margin:0; font-size:12px; line-height:26px}
a img{ border:0;}

.content1{ margin-bottom:10px;}
.content{width:940px;margin:0 auto; padding:0}
a:link {color:#000;text-decoration: none;}
a:visited {color:#000;text-decoration: none;}
a:hover {color:#f00;text-decoration: none;}
a:active {color:#f00;text-decoration: none;}

.top{ background-image:url(../images/top_bg.jpg)}
.menu a:link,.menu a:visited{ padding-top:3px;font-size:13px; width:90px; height:30px; line-height:30px; display:block; font-weight:bolder; color:#fff;text-decoration: none; text-align:center; }
.menu a:hover,.menu a:active {padding-top:3px;font-size:13px; width:90px; height:30px;line-height:30px; display:block; font-weight:bolder;color:#333;text-decoration: none;text-align:center; background-image:url(../images/menu_hover.jpg);}

.menu a.current:link,a.current:visited,a.current:hover,a.current:active {padding-top:3px;font-size:13px; width:90px; height:30px;line-height:30px; display:block; font-weight:bolder;color:#333;text-decoration: none;text-align:center; background-image:url(../images/menu_hover.jpg);}

.has_line{background-image:url(../images/a_bg.jpg); background-repeat:no-repeat}
.cp_class{ background-image:url(../images/r_bg.jpg); background-repeat:no-repeat; font-weight:bolder; padding-left:28px; height:31px; line-height:31px; color:#FFF}
.cp_class_list{background-color:#dfd7c2; border-left:#cfc6b4 1px solid; border-right:#cfc6b4 1px solid; padding-left:20px; height:30px; }
.cp_class_list a{ width:190px; display:block; border-bottom:#666 1px dashed; background-image:url(../images/point.gif); background-repeat:no-repeat; background-position:left; padding-left:15px}
.r_contact{background-color:#dfd7c2; border-left:#cfc6b4 1px solid; border-right:#cfc6b4 1px solid; border-bottom:#cfc6b4 1px solid; padding-left:20px;}


.bottom{ background-image:url(../images/f_bg.jpg); background-repeat:repeat-x; color:#666; font-size:12px; line-height:24px; padding:20px}


